Abstract
The invention discloses a kind of computer displays convenient for adjusting, belong to computer display field.A kind of computer display convenient for adjusting, including touch screen and pedestal are fixedly connected with symmetrical first support plate on the pedestal.It may be implemented the second shaft and drives first gear rotation by the 4th gear, first gear pushes support inserted link by rack gear, to support inserted link that touch screen is risen to certain altitude, the second shaft drives first rotating shaft rotation by the 5th gear and second gear simultaneously, to which first rotating shaft changes touch screen tilt angle by support rod, the height and tilt angle of touch screen are adjusted simultaneously, in addition while rack gear pushes support inserted link to be detached from support rod, first connecting rod and the second connecting rod push touch screen to turn an angle around support inserted link, to further adjust touch screen tilt angle, operating process is simple, convenient for operation.

Background technique
Computer display is also generally referred to as computer monitor or computer screen.It is in addition to CPU, mainboard, interior
It deposits, a most important computer part except power supply, keyboard, mouse, with the development of technology, touching-type monitor makes extensively
With.
Currently, needing touch screen to tilt certain angle touching-type monitor to meet the different use demands of user
Degree, the display of the prior art, usual height adjustment and tilt angle adjusting all independently carry out, the adjustment process of display
It needs to make two bites at a cherry, first adjustment height rotates angle again up and down, or first rotation angle carries out upper-lower height adjusting again, operates
Process is cumbersome, inconvenient for operation;In addition when carrying out height adjustment, in order to avoid display center of gravity because display device angle and
Height change and have significantly that offset causes toppling over for display, when adjusting height of display, need to maintain display it is straight on
Adjusting under directly, operate inconvenience.

Working principle: when touch screen 1 is adjusted, the second shaft 15, the second shaft 15 are rotated by rotational handle 13
On the 5th gear 6 and the 6th gear 14 drive second gear 7 and third gear 12 to rotate simultaneously, consequently facilitating driving first turn
Axis 11 rotates, and first rotating shaft 11 drives support rod 4 to rotate, so that support rod 4 drives the rotation of touch screen 1 one by support inserted link 5
Determine angle, while the second shaft 15 drives the rotation of the 4th gear 17, so that the 4th gear 17 drives first gear 9 to rotate, first
Gear 9 is rotated around first rotating shaft 11, and first gear 9 pushes push plate 21 by rack gear 16, so that push plate 21 pushes support inserted link 5,
Support inserted link 5 progressively disengages support rod 4, to support inserted link 5 that touch screen 1 is risen to certain altitude, the height of touch screen 1 and
Tilt angle is adjusted simultaneously, and when support inserted link 5 is detached from support rod 4, the second connecting rod 25 is fixedly connected on support rod 4, thus
Second connecting rod 25 pulls 28 lower end of first connecting rod, while 28 upper end of first connecting rod pushes touch screen 1 to rotate, thus again
Angular adjustment is carried out, ensure that the center of gravity G for adjusting front and back touch screen 1 in the certain area above pedestal 2, ensure that display
Center of gravity do not have because of the angle of display device and height change and significantly deviate, operating process is simple, convenient for operation.
